How much do part time international golf course superintendent j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 6, 2026, the average yearly pay for part time international golf course superintendent in the United States is $67,615.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50,000.00 and $79,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a part time international golf course superintendent?

Part time international golf course superintendents are professionals responsible for overseeing the maintenance and management of golf courses in various countries, but on a part-time basis. Their duties include supervising grounds staff, ensuring the course is in optimal playing condition, and managing budgets and supplies. Working internationally, they must adapt to different climates, grass types, and local regulations while maintaining high standards. Part-time roles may involve seasonal work or consulting for several courses, offering flexibility but also requiring strong organizational sk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time international golf course superintendent?

To thrive as a Part Time International Golf Course Superintendent, you need expertise in turfgrass management, horticulture, and a solid understanding of agronomic principles, often supported by a degree in turf management or related field. Familiarity with irrigation systems, maintenance equipment, and industry certifications such as GCSAA membership are typically required. Strong leadership, cultural sensitivity, and effective communication are essential soft skills for managing diverse teams and liaising with stakeholders. These skills ensure the course meets international standards for playability and aesthetics while optimizing resources in a global setting.
